Eggesford Station is a quaint, no-frills facility. It lacks a ticket office and ticket machines, so passengers should purchase tickets online or through other means before arriving. Surprisingly, the station provides an induction loop, enhancing accessibility for those with hearing aids—a thoughtful touch in this serene rural setting where technology isn't always at the forefront.
While the station does not have a waiting room or refreshment facilities, it does offer a seating area where passengers can relax while waiting for their train. The step-free access ensures the station accommodates travelers with mobility needs. Additionally, the help points available are quite handy, as there’s no staff assistance present throughout the week.
The station facilitates onward travel connections seamlessly despite its lack of extensive transport amenities. Rail replacement services can be availed right at the station's front, on A377. For those opting for bus connections, specific details can be conveniently accessed and printed out from online resources.

Tyseley Train Station is equipped to cater to the needs of travelers with various facilities. For those buying tickets, there is a ticket office open weekdays from 07:00 to 09:00, and automatic ticket machines available, though they are not accessible for all users. The station features induction loops for hearing-impaired passengers. While luggage storage and CCTV services are unavailable, customer information is readily accessible through departure screens and announcements. Help is available from staff Monday to Friday during limited morning hours, ensuring assistance when needed.
Accessibility at Tyseley Station is only partial, with step-free access limited and no accessible toilets available. Assistance is available through Passenger Assist, but it's advisable to book this service in advance.
Planning to continue your journey from Tyseley? The station offers several options for onward travel. Rail replacement services operate from the nearby A41 Warwick Road, making it easy to continue your journey towards Stratford or Birmingham. For those preferring taxis, services such as Tyseley Station Ontime, Bee Line, and Ace are available. Local bus services are well-integrated with train schedules, and helpful resources are available in printable formats to guide you through your onward journey.
